PeopleForBikes launches letter writing campaign to restore funding for bike projects threatened by Trump

BOULDER, Colo. (BRAIN) — PeopleForBikes says President Trump’s 2018 proposed budget is not good for bicycling. The group said the budget proposes to cut overall funding for the Department of the Interior by 5.3 percent and the Department of Transportation by 16 percent.

“If approved, this budget will cut funding for bike trails and paths in our National Parks and National Recreation Areas. It will reduce support for the Land and Water Conservation Fund, which has helped create some of the best places to ride in the U.S. The budget also guts the TIGER grant program, which is instrumental in helping communities fund multimodal transportation projects that often improve bicycling.”

The organization has begun a letter writing campaign in hopes that Congress can restore funding for the programs. A letter writing tool located on the PeopleForBikes website helps voters identify and reach their representatives.
